Depends on how much you want to shell out and what style.

For less expensive versions, have a look at Windrose razor handles on eBay. Not sure if matte/satin are available at the moment, though. £16/piece plus postage.

Jurgen Hempel makes some very nice stainless or titan handles. Contact him on skydiver6000@gmx.de. 90 EUR/piece.

Then there's this Belarus handle producer called Stork. Believe @Bechet got one from there?

There are also custom handle makers on Etsy. No idea about quality, but cost is reasonable. Marley Machine Works in Canada is one.

Maggards has plenty of handles at a low cost too and relatively regularly come up with new and or limited editions.
